Atkaro water well

On 27th November 2010, thanks to the financial backing of the La Casa dell’Albero Foundation in Fossoli di Carpi, and thanks to the generosity of all the people who supported this initiative, a well was unveiled in the village of Atkaro (district of Alitena), in the administrative province of Erob, Tigray Region, Ethiopia. It is approximately 70 metres deep and able to provide drinking water to around 500 people.

The well was drilled to a depth of around 70 metres and is operated by a hand pump, not simply because of the lack of electricity, but to make its maintenance easier.

It has an excellent water flow and it can ensure clean water provisions for over five hundred people, in particular women and children who live in the village of Diblah and in the neighbouring villages in the district of Alitena.
